After trying around with few permutations I was able to get rid of this error 
by changing the datastax-cassandra-connector version to 1.1.0.alpha. Could it 
be related to a bug in alpha4? But why would it manifest itself as a class 
loading error?

On 27 Oct 2014, at 12:10, Saket Kumar <saket.ku...@bgch.co.uk> wrote:

> Hello all,
> 
> I am trying to run a Spark job but while running the job I am getting missing 
> class errors. First I got a missing class error for Joda DateTime, I added 
> the dependency in my build.sbt and rebuilt the assembly jar and tried again. 
> This time I am getting the same error for java.util.Date. I find that error 
> odd as I shouldn’t have to package a core java class in the assembly package. 
> Am I missing something? Shouldn’t it load the class from rt. jar?
